LA GOTTA SWIMSUIT 

Zariah Grapefruit swimsuit. Photography courtesy of @lagottaofficial

La Gotta (inspired by the Spanish word la gota meaning “drop of water”) is a Miami-based swimwear line offering chic suits in clean, simple neutrals to playful prints and patterns inspired by nature. You can feel good ordering from this environmentally conscious brand that uses recycled threads and water sparingly.

KOKOMO CUSTOM SURFBOARD

Custom surfboard by Kokomo Surf Co. Photography courtesy of Kokomo Surf Co.

Originally based in Clearwater but recently relocated to Maui, Kokomo Surf Co. crafts custom-made, hollow wooden surfboards. They also offer DIY build kits for the surfers who want control over every curve and fin. Talk about a perfect fit.

HANDMADE BOGAERT BOARDS

Custom stand-up paddle board. Photography courtesy of Bogaert Boards

Love stand-up paddleboarding? Then you’ll really love these one-of-a-kind boards that are handcrafted in Deerfield Beach. Bogaert Boards provide you with comfort, quality, and most importantly, unbeatable style. Each board is made with special UV-resistant resin to prolong its life, and the team will work with you to make all your design dreams come true.
